Blue Cross-Blue Shield Building

Office building in Chicago, Illinois From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The Blue Cross-Blue Shield Building is an office building at 55 West Wacker Drive in the Loop in Downtown Chicago, Illinois. It was designed in a Brutalist style by C.F. Murphy Associates. The building opened in 1968 as the headquarters for BlueCross BlueShield of Illinois.[1] Foreign tenants of this Building includes the Taipei Economic and Cultural Office in Chicago (TECO-Chicago), the consular post of Taiwan in Illinois.[2]
